The game acts much like a more strategy oriented hero focused game, acting a lot like World of Warcraft or a MOBA Game in that you pick one of three heroes, level up, find equipment and try to complete missions as well as small quests in the maps themselves for bonuses. The game's story is a mix of light cyberpunk and vampire story elements as well as a very obvious inspiration from the movie Escape from New York. The situation the three characters are forced into is amazingly similar, being ordered by a government entity to be introduced inside the city in order to handle a very sensitive mission they could not use the real police for.

Boris, Angel, and Porter are the three playable heroes with their own play style. Porter uses SMG's and Rifles and represent ranged Damage Per Second potential along with casting support abilities. Angel is a Melee Tank character that can use knives and swords. Boris uses dual pistols or revolvers and has the highest henchmen cap, where henchmen are much like pets that can be hired and level up with the character.

The game was generally ignored for lacking much of the gameplay and content of the game Gangland, which Paradise City was supposed to be a sequel to. It is also notable for its horrendous campaign missions, which all boil down to "Level up, do busywork, kill level boss" with tiny variations along with the requirement to fully level up all three characters with their own story arch in a way thats much like just playing three mini-campaigns in order. There are three versions of the last mission, one for each character; with the same goal of killing the Head vampire.

Many of the games plot twists are often considered bad writing and usually unexplained. It is heavily suggested that either through sex or biting Porter is turned into a Vampire; as after meeting Lydia(A vampire) the local vampire hunters die in droves for the chance to assassinate Porter. Nearly all of the vampire characters are never given a backstory or explained, and the realization that Paradise City is run by vampires is pretty much met with no surprise. In similar fashion the Head Vampire has no discernible backstory or personality is granted to spectacular boss battle or cutscene, as well as puts up no fight as one of the saddest boss fights in RPG history.

The various equipment, items and characters in the game do suggest a slight cyberpunk background that is taken for granted. Items such as Biotic Armor, powerful stimulant drugs and nanofibers are in large supply in town and as a agent even after Boris kills Kovacs you are granted a large arsenal of support abilities such as Snipers, Gang Hits, Poison Bombs and other direct means of support.

The game feature no skirmish mode, and multiplayer servers are rumored to be down. Multiplayer allows players to pick one of the three characters and battle for points or kills. Such as three deaths and you are out. Multiplayer was geniunely fun, but the games terrible story gameplay and AI scared many players away before they could give it a chance.
